My metal panels have scratches on them. What can I do?

According to AEP Span: 

Touch-up paint pens are available and applied manually after installation to repair minor scratches and chips on metal panels. Paint pens have a small applicator tip that will fit into the scratches. It is important to note that touch up-paint will not have the same color retention or weatherability as the original factory finish. Touch-up paint should be purchased from the metal roofing supplier, rather than going to your local hardware store. For more information, view our blog on Touch-Up Paint.
